代碼行內有中文的空格,非文字字符. ...
在寫博客時直接將博客上的代碼復制運行后發現錯誤SyntaxError: invalid character in identifier,我以為是l 小L 寫成了 ,改了還是不行。 上網查了下,發現原來是不可見字符在搞鬼 把代碼粘貼到Notepad 上用ASCII編碼立馬現出了原型 原來的TAB空白就變成了這些東東,去掉它們改為空格或TAB即可 ...
2018-04-13 16:16 0 12325 推薦指數:
代碼行內有中文的空格,非文字字符. ...
第一次寫Python出現如下錯誤 解釋器提示如:SyntaxError: invalid character in identifier, 但又一直找不到問題點的話,一般可以從以下幾方面考慮: 1、代碼行內夾雜中文的空格,tab等 2、包含 非英文字符 3、包含 非英文半角下的標點符號 ...
python報錯invalid character in identifier,意思就是“標識符中的無效字符”,檢查下有沒有字符是中文的,把中文字符改成英文字符再運行就可以了。 Python的作者有意的設計限制性很強的語法,使得不好的編程習慣(例如if語句的下一行不向右縮進)都不能通過編譯 ...
編寫python代碼時出現SyntaxError: invalid character in identifier的解決方法 這個錯誤一般情況下是出現了非法的空格,一些高級的編輯器會直接出現紅色的波浪線提示錯誤,但是如果像jupyter notebook這些環境下是不會提示的,所以這個錯誤 ...
:非英文符號 ...
python命名不能以數字開頭,import時會報錯 ...
Error: SyntaxError: invalid syntax Where? 運行Python代碼時候,提示錯誤 Way? Python def class if elif for while 等語句末尾沒有加上 : 關鍵符號 Way? 檢查對應 def ...
Python_報錯:SyntaxError: unexpected character after line continuation character 原因:寫入的文件內容不正確,應處理為字符串 寫成這樣就ok了:os.chdir(time_year+ ...